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Elstree & Borehamwood to Whitchurch (Cardiff) start from as little as £27.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Elstree & Borehamwood to Whitchurch (Cardiff) start from £102.50 one way, or £103.50 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Elstree & Borehamwood to Whitchurch (Cardiff) are available for £149.50 one way, or £299.00 return

Facilities at Elstree & Borehamwood

Elstree & Borehamwood station is equipped with several amenities to ensure a comfortable experience. The ticket office is open every day of the week, with longer hours on Sunday (06:30 to 21:15). If you prefer self-service, there are ticket machines available that also support the issuing of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. In case you've purchased your tickets online, you can collect them using these machines.

Catering to accessibility needs, the station provides step-free access to all platforms. For those requiring assistance, Elstree & Borehamwood station is staffed throughout the day to help passengers navigate the station or board trains. The Help Point acts as a convenient resource for real-time travel information or emergencies, supported by CCTV surveillance ensuring your safety. Although there's no waiting room, seating areas are present for your comfort.

Facilities and Amenities at Whitchurch (Cardiff)

While Whitchurch (Cardiff) station doesn't boast a ticket office, you'll find convenient ticket machines available for purchasing and collecting tickets, ensuring your travel preparations are as seamless as possible. Smartcard validators are present, although the issuance of new smartcards isn't available. For those requiring assistance, the station is partially accessible, with step-free access provided from Pen y Dre. Despite a lack of waiting rooms, Whitchurch ensures some seating areas for those waiting for their train.

Security is prioritized with CCTV coverage, and cyclists will find ample bike storage with 12 spaces adjacent to the platforms. Unfortunately, those looking for refreshment services or ATM facilities may need to explore nearby areas before arriving at the station.
